Pros

Being part of the largest information security company in North America is a pretty cool opportunity. We get to do amazing things for our clients and represent the largest technology partners in the world. The leadership team is a combination of the best from Accuvant and FishNet and they're doing an amazing job of putting these 2 companies together. It's given people new growth opportunities, promotions, and is starting to address the problems that both companies were unable to address separately (systems consolidations, process flow problems, etc). It really is a great company that provides a fantastic quality of life.

Cons

Integration of the 2 companies has it's challenges as you'd imagine. Putting 2 $750M companies together is no small feat. Moving so fast sometimes things get missed and creates opportunities to come back and touch things a second time. Creating a single company means rolling out new processes, systems, and employee benefits. There's just no way around it. However, some people are hung up on the "way it used to be at Accuvant/FishNet" and get upset when it didn't go the way they think it should have. I don't worry about it much as those things are all expected, but some of the reviews here come from a very small point of view.
